I decided to bake my dessert wantons instead of frying them. I was on a apple/pear phase when I made these. I sauteed chopped apples/pears with a little butter and cinnamon. Filled them up in the wantons and baked them 10 mins on each side at 350 degrees.
These came out sooo yummy. Add some ice cream and it makes a great dessert. Hot soup for dinner and a cool dessert to cool you down.
